Requirements Description: The ELEVATING AND TRAVE ( Elevation Drive Assembly) is a device for elevating and traversing a weapon to its desired firing position. TANK, M1 ABRAMS FAMILY OF VEHICLES (FOV). The Elevation Drive Assembly consists of a motor brake assembly, planetary reduction unit, manual drive, output pinion, and anti-backlash drive mount mechanism. The assembly elevates or depresses the weapon of the Stabilized Commander Weapon Station (SCWS) in either powered or manual mode. The Elevation Drive controls the elevation/depression of the Commanders machine gun in the SCWS for M1A1 tanks.
